Police confirm the body recovered near Glasgow is missing Cork student

Police in Scotland have confirmed the body found on farmland near Glasgow is missing Cork student Karen Buckley. The 24-year-old disappeared after leaving a nightclub in the city on Sunday morning. A statement released on behalf of her family says they are "heartbroken". It goes on to say 'Karen was our only daughter, cherished by our family and loved by her friends. We will miss her terribly. The family have also appealed for privacy at this time. Detective Superintendent Jim Kerr says a man arrested in connection with Karen Buckley's disappearance is expected to appear in court tomorrow.
